A Sunday Funny

It was my turn to teach the 3, 4, and 5 year olds today. I shared the story of the rich man who came to Jesus and was instructed to give away his wealth. Before I told the story, I brought out a big box of cereal that I pretended I wanted to eat, all by myself. Instead, I decided to SHARE my BIG box of cereal with them, and exclaimed how much better it tasted when I SHARED. I asked "What do you think Jesus wants you to do with all the things you have, because we all have lots and lots of stuff, don't we!" A very bright, precocious 5 year old shot up her hand and when called upon, proudly and confidently exclaimed:

"Have a yard sale!"
Oh gosh, it was so hard not to laugh out loud right then and there.
